Subject: Logistics Provider Transition

Dear Executive Team,

Following the six-month review, Marcellon Goods will transition from Trevane Freight to Aldercrest Logistics effective next quarter. Aldercrest offers consolidated cold-chain handling, a 9% cost reduction, and better coverage across the Velmore corridor. Transition risks centre on the first two weeks; a dual-running arrangement is in place. Board members should treat the rationale, noted confidentially below, as restricted.

board note of fahif-yahog: Gross margin on Wenath came in at 10 percent against a plan of 5 percent. Only 3 of the 100 pilot accounts renewed Wenath, so a churn review is set for July 15.

Handover note — Almsgiver receipt mailer

To whoever maintains this next: the mailer retries bounced receipts three times, then parks them in the dead-letter queue. The template cache invalidates on deploy, not on edit — known quirk, low priority. Quarterly key rotation is documented in the ops wiki. To unseal the backup signing key during rotation, use the recovery passphrase below.

unlock words, kawig-bawef: belax-sorir-druax-ulaiel-wenael-belael

Ticket #4182 — GPU memory profiler misconfigured on staging

The Vramscope profiling agent on the Kestrelgrid staging cluster is pointing at the production metrics collector, so staging runs are polluting prod dashboards. Root cause: the env file on node pool C was copied from prod without edits. Fix is to update the collector endpoint and rotate the agent credential. The corrected env file should include the following line:

sealed setting: LEDGER_TOKEN13=5d842615a26d7

## Tuning

FeeCrafter's rules engine decides shipping fees per order, and yes, the defaults are opinionated. If a merchant on the Parcelgrove plan complains about weird surcharges, it's almost always one of the knobs below rather than a bug. Changing a value takes effect on the next rule reload, so no restart needed — just don't crank the distance multiplier without checking with eng. Current defaults follow.

tuning table, kageg-kagap:
CAPS = {
    "druox": 842,
    "quenax": 605,
    "zormir": 107,
    "tamwyn": 577,
    "kasok": 688,
}